For most Rolling Loud festivals, you need to be at least 16 years old, but it depends on the specific location and year, and some editions are now all- ages or 18+.

General age rules

  • The main Rolling Loud terms state a minimum age of 16 for the event, describing it as intended for ā€œmature audiences.ā€
  • Some recent editions (like Rolling Loud Cali 2026) list the age minimum as 16+ on festival info sites.

ā€œAll agesā€ and exceptions

  • Current ticket info for the main Rolling Loud site says GA tickets are ā€œall ages permitted entry,ā€ but still requires valid ID at entry and has stricter ages for VIP and alcohol (18+ for certain VIP tickets, 21+ to drink).
  • In some markets, the age limit is higher: for example, Rolling Loud Australia 2026 is listed as 18+ only.

What this means for you

  • If you are under 16: you generally cannot attend most Rolling Loud editions that keep the 16+ minimum, and you definitely cannot attend 18+ editions.
  • If you are 16 or 17: you can usually attend standard GA at many Rolling Louds, but you still cannot legally drink and some VIP options require 18+.
  • If you are 18+: you can attend any edition that is 18+ or 16+, and you may be eligible for 18+ VIP offerings; alcohol remains 21+ in places like the U.S.

Safety and vibe (from forums)

  • Festival-goers on forums often suggest waiting until at least 16–17 because the pits and crowds can be intense for younger teens.
  • People also note that even at ā€œall agesā€ editions, it can feel like an adult party environment with rough crowds, mosh pits, and substance use visible around you.

How to get the exact answer for your city

  • Check the official Rolling Loud website for the specific city/year (e.g., ā€œMiami 2026 ticketsā€ or ā€œCali 2026 ticketsā€) and look for the ā€œage minimumā€ or ā€œticketing termsā€ section. These pages spell out whether it is all ages, 16+, or 18+.
  • Also look at local promo pages (like Music Festival Wizard or the local ticketing site) because they often repeat the exact age limit for that edition.

In short, ā€œhow old do you have to be to go to Rolling Loud?ā€
Usually at least 16 , but some editions are all ages and some are 18+ , so always confirm the specific festival’s rules for that year and location.
